Missing Ruth "Ruthy" Ann Lemon Modesto CA August 19, 1992
Nickname - Ruthy
Missing -08/19/1982
Modesto, California
Date of Birth
02/25/1966 (53 years old current age)
Age when last seen
16 years old
Height 5’5"
Weight 84 pounds
Clothing/Jewelry Description
A cream-colored t-shirt with writing on it, Levi’s jeans, a gold chain necklace with a cross, and four or five rings.
Distinguishing Characteristics
Caucasian female. Brown hair, brown eyes. Ruth has a small cross tattoo on the web of her right hand between her thumb and index finger. Her ears are pierced.
In 1982, Ruthy was living with her guardian
She became acquainted with two men. Both were in their thirties. This incident occurred on August 19 of that year. Ruth made plans to meet the men later that evening at Sam’s Food City at Carver Road and Teresa Street, three blocks from her home. She was last seen at approximately 8:45 P.M. after she left her guardian’s residence. She said she was walking to Sam’s Food City to purchase a soft drink.
Ruth did in fact arrive at the store. She vanished afterward. Her guardian was at work during Ruth’s scheduled arrival time at home and did not realize she was missing until approximately 7:00 A.M. on August 20, the following morning. Ruth has never been seen again. Authorities questioned the two men scheduled to meet Ruth during the night she vanished, but both denied any involvement in her case.
Wesley Howard Shermantine Jr. and Loren Joseph Herzog are the so-called “Speed Freak Killers.” They are possible suspects in Ruth’s case. They were arrested in 2000 and ultimately convicted of murdering several females in the 1980’s and 1990s; authorities believe they had as many as fifteen victims.
Shermantine lead investigators to the skeletal remains of Chevelle Wheeler and Cyndi Vanderheiden. They had been missing since 1985 and 1998 respectively. He also pointed out an abandoned well in Linden, California that contained some 300 human bones and personal items. Shermantine stated the well contains up to twenty victims. He blames Herzog for all the murders and says he only helped with disposing the bodies. Authorities are in the process of sorting out the contents of the well and attempting to identify the bones.
Ruthy had met Herzog before her disappearance; she and a female friend went to the Calaveras County Frog Jump with him
